The Kitchen Suppression Systems – Virtual Hands-On provides an in-depth, virtual hands-on demonstration of pre-engineered kitchen suppression systems. Using video-enhanced instruction, students will gain a better understanding of the inspection, testing and maintenance (ITM) for common systems found in the field. This course also includes a review of some key NFPA codes to ensure compliance and operational effectiveness.
This training is ideal for technicians and other industry professionals seeking advance knowledge of kitchen suppression systems, whether for maintenance, compliance or professional development.
Content includes educating participants with the following topics:
- NFPA 96 and NFPA 17A Code Review
- Virtual ITM Demonstrations on leading OEM systems:
-
- Protex II
- Amerex MRM
- Amerex PRM
- Ansul R-102
- Ansul Piranha
- Buckeye Kitchen Mister
- Kidde/Badger Range guard
This course is intended to provide basic information of Kitchen Systems and is not designed to replace OEM training.
